Software til screencasting ? tips ?
Jeg overvejer lidt at lave et par screencasts - muligvis bare for at informere nogle medstuderende om noget C programmering (ergo - på dansk), ikke noget stort.
Til formålet forestiller jeg mig behov for
1) optage lyd til formålet (oooh crap, here comes PulseAudio... :/ )
2) optage min desktop (for tiden er KDE 4.7 under test eftersom KanalTux EP 6 gav en glimrende gennemgang, tak til dem!)
Jeg går ud fra man kunne optage lyd og video for sig og så sætte tingene sammen i Openshot.. ?
Jeg ser frem til eventuelle forslag da det er første gang jeg overhovedet overvejer at lave sådanne ting :)
Til formålet forestiller jeg mig behov for
1) optage lyd til formålet (oooh crap, here comes PulseAudio... :/ )
2) optage min desktop (for tiden er KDE 4.7 under test eftersom KanalTux EP 6 gav en glimrende gennemgang, tak til dem!)
Jeg går ud fra man kunne optage lyd og video for sig og så sætte tingene sammen i Openshot.. ?
Jeg ser frem til eventuelle forslag da det er første gang jeg overhovedet overvejer at lave sådanne ting :)
Kommentarer9
Jeg plejer at bruge
Jeg plejer at bruge ffmpeg,
Mere præcist (hust at tilpasse opløsning):
sleep 10 && ffmpeg -f x11grab -s 1280x1024 -r 25 -i :0.0 -sameq screencast.mpg
Har ikke haft behov for lyd. Er det noget lyd du vil indtale selv? eller er det systemlyde?
#2
Lyd jeg selv vil indtale
Lyd jeg selv vil indtale :) Skulle gerne bruges til at guide folk lidt igennem et par aspekter af C udvikling
Jeg plejer også at bruge
RecordMyDesktop kommer til
Jeg tillader mig lige at
Som cb400f siger, kan ffmpeg sagtens benyttes, og da jeg nu er hjemme ved min egen coputer, vil jeg da lige dele denne med jer:
ffmpeg -f x11grab -r 30 -s '$(xdpyinfo | grep 'dimensions:' | awk '{ print $2 }')' -i :0.0 -vcodec libx264 -preset ultrafast -crf 0 /tmp/output.mkv
Den optager hele din skærm i H264/30fps, læser automagisk din skærmstørrelse, pakker det hele i en mkv og gemmer filen i /tmp/output.mkv. Umiddelbart er det den bedste løsning jeg har fundet, omend filerne ender med at fylde en del - Så er I advaret.
Den optager ikke lyd, men det var heller ikke det du ledte efter.
Et eksempel på ffmpeg med
ffmpeg -f alsa -ac 2 -i pulse -f x11grab -r 30 -s 1920x1080 -i :0.0 -qscale 1 -acodec alac -vcodec libx264 -vpre lossless_ultrafast -threads 0 output.m4v
Den vælger det input som er aktivt, så hvis man har stillet sine lyd indstillinger til mikrofon, optager den det. Ellers kan man sætte sin lyd til Monitor of internal audio, eller hvad man nu bruger. Hvis dette er aktivt, vil ffmpeg optage fra lydkortet.
Jeg er ret sikker på, at du
-vpre lossless_ultrafast -threads 0
til
-preset ultrafast -crf 0
i nyere udgaver af ffmpeg - Ellers mener jeg at den klager om manglende preset-indstillinger.
Det er muligt :)
Men den
Men den giver i hvert fald lyd. Så må man rette det så det passer til den individuelle.